Package pysynphot :: Module observationmode :: Class _ThermalObservationMode
[hide private]
[frames] | no frames]

Class _ThermalObservationMode

source code

         object --+    
                  |    
BaseObservationMode --+
                      |
                     _ThermalObservationMode

Instance Methods [hide private]
 
__init__(self, obsmode, method='HSTGraphTable', graphtable=None, comptable=None, thermtable=None)
x.__init__(...) initializes x; see x.__class__.__doc__ for signature
source code
 
_getPixelScale(self) source code
 
_getThermalComponents(self, throughput_filenames, thermal_filenames) source code
 
_multiplyThroughputs(self)
Overrides base class in order to deal with opaque components.
source code
 
_getSpectrum(self) source code
 
_getWavesetIntersection(self) source code
 
_mergeEmissivityWavesets(self) source code
 
_bb(self, wave, temperature) source code

Inherited from BaseObservationMode: GetFileNames, __len__, __str__, bandWave, showfiles

Inherited from object: __delattr__, __getattribute__, __hash__, __new__, __reduce__, __reduce_ex__, __repr__, __setattr__

Properties [hide private]

Inherited from object: __class__

Method Details [hide private]

__init__(self, obsmode, method='HSTGraphTable', graphtable=None, comptable=None, thermtable=None)
(Constructor)

source code 

x.__init__(...) initializes x; see x.__class__.__doc__ for signature

Overrides: object.__init__
(inherited documentation)